Don’t expect to see any cats or llamas on the Million Paws Walk — it’s strictly a dog affair.
Organisers are still counting up the numbers but a simple glance at the hundreds participants said enough.
“It was very busy,” event co-ordinator Erin Parkinson said.
“Apparently we had the record for the number of online registrations.”
While previously strange participants like guinea pigs were kept at home this year there were some pleasantly odd sights.
“There were a couple of elderly dogs that were too old to walk so they were pushed around in prams,” Ms Parkinson said.
Funds raised from the walk are sent to the charity’s head office in Melbourne.
“It’s the biggest fund-raiser of the year for the RSPCA,” she said.
